/**
* contractBlocksService — CRUD for the contract block library.
*
* The library is shared across all contracts. System blocks (12 seeded
* by migration 130) cannot be deleted but their body text remains
* editable so the admin's lawyer can rewrite them. Admin-authored
* (non-system) blocks can be freely created, edited, and removed.
*
* Sections are validated against a fixed enum mirroring
* contractService.SECTIONS_ORDER — keeping these in sync is the
* "data-driven all the way down" guarantee (no orphan sections in
* the DB that the renderer can't display).
*/
const { db, withRetry } = require('../database/db');
const logger = require('../utils/logger');
const { AppError } = require('../utils/errors');
const { hasColumnCached } = require('../utils/schemaCache');
const ALLOWED_SECTIONS = ['basics', 'scope', 'privacy', 'commercial', 'nda', 'closing'];
/**
* System blocks added to the seed AFTER migration 131 was already
* deployed to beta. knex won't re-run an already-applied migration,
* so the new system blocks listed here need a runtime self-heal —
* same pattern as `ensureContractEmailTemplatesSeeded` for templates.
*
* Each entry must carry every column the row needs. `slug` is the
* uniqueness key; the seeder is no-op when the row already exists.
* EN/DE bodies only — non-EN/DE locales stay null until the admin
* fills them in via the block library UI.
*/
const RUNTIME_SEEDED_BLOCKS = [
{
slug: 'quote_line_items_table',
section: 'scope',
name: 'Quote line items',
description: 'Auto-inserts the source quote\'s line items as a table. Body text appears above the table.',
body_text: 'Service items per quote {{source_quote_number}}:',
body_text_de: 'Leistungspositionen gemäß Angebot {{source_quote_number}}:',
is_system: true,
is_active: true,
},
];
// Module-scope flag so the seed check runs once per process. The
// underlying queries are still idempotent — this just saves the round
// trip on every listBlocks / createContract call.
let _systemBlocksSeeded = false;
/**
* Self-heal: insert any RUNTIME_SEEDED_BLOCKS entries that don't yet
* exist in contract_blocks. Called from listBlocks + createContract
* paths so new system blocks appear automatically on installs that
* applied an earlier version of migration 131. Idempotent.
*/
async function ensureSystemBlocksSeeded() {
if (_systemBlocksSeeded) return [];
if (!(await db.schema.hasTable('contract_blocks'))) return [];
const newlyInserted = [];
for (const def of RUNTIME_SEEDED_BLOCKS) {
try {
const existing = await db('contract_blocks').where({ slug: def.slug }).first();
if (existing) continue;
// display_order = current MAX in the target section + 1 so the
// new block sorts to the end. Matches the migration's behaviour.
const maxOrderRow = await db('contract_blocks')
.where({ section: def.section })
.max('display_order as max').first();
const nextOrder = (maxOrderRow?.max || 0) + 1;
await db('contract_blocks').insert({
...def,
display_order: nextOrder,
created_at: new Date(),
updated_at: new Date(),
});
newlyInserted.push(def.slug);
logger.info(`Self-healed missing system contract block at runtime: ${def.slug}`);
} catch (err) {
logger.error(`Failed to seed system contract block ${def.slug}`, { message: err.message });
// Keep _systemBlocksSeeded=false so the next call retries.
return newlyInserted;
}
}
_systemBlocksSeeded = true;
return newlyInserted;
}
function ensureSection(section) {
if (!ALLOWED_SECTIONS.includes(section)) {
throw new AppError(
`Invalid section '${section}'. Must be one of: ${ALLOWED_SECTIONS.join(', ')}`,
400,
'INVALID_SECTION',
);
}
}
function slugify(name) {
const base = String(name || 'block')
.toLowerCase()
.normalize('NFKD')
.replace(/[\u0300-\u036f]/g, '')
.replace(/[^a-z0-9]+/g, '_')
.replace(/^_+|_+$/g, '')
.slice(0, 48);
// Append a 6-hex suffix so admin-authored blocks don't collide with
// each other or with seeded slugs.
const suffix = require('crypto').randomBytes(3).toString('hex');
return `${base || 'block'}_${suffix}`;
}
async function listBlocks({ section, includeInactive = false } = {}) {
// Self-heal before reading so the new system block (added to the
// already-deployed migration 131 in feat/crm) appears in the
// library UI immediately on first GET, without needing a fresh
// install. Safe to call repeatedly — guarded by _systemBlocksSeeded.
await ensureSystemBlocksSeeded();
return await withRetry(async () => {
let q = db('contract_blocks').select('*');
if (section) q = q.where({ section });
if (!includeInactive) q = q.where({ is_active: true });
q = q.orderBy('section', 'asc').orderBy('display_order', 'asc').orderBy('id', 'asc');
return await q;
});
}
async function getBlockById(id) {
return await db('contract_blocks').where({ id }).first();
}
async function createBlock(payload) {
if (!payload.name || !String(payload.name).trim()) {
throw new AppError('Block name is required', 400);
}
ensureSection(payload.section);
if (!payload.bodyText || !String(payload.bodyText).trim()) {
throw new AppError('Block body (EN) is required', 400);
}
const slug = payload.slug && /^[a-z0-9_]+$/.test(payload.slug)
? payload.slug
: slugify(payload.name);
// Ensure slug uniqueness (regenerate on the rare collision).
let finalSlug = slug;
let attempt = 0;
while (await db('contract_blocks').where({ slug: finalSlug }).first()) {
attempt += 1;
finalSlug = slugify(payload.name);
if (attempt > 5) {
throw new AppError('Could not generate a unique block slug', 500);
}
}
const row = {
slug: finalSlug,
section: payload.section,
name: String(payload.name).trim().slice(0, 128),
description: payload.description ? String(payload.description).slice(0, 255) : null,
body_text: String(payload.bodyText),
body_text_de: payload.bodyTextDe ? String(payload.bodyTextDe) : null,
is_system: false,
is_active: payload.isActive !== false,
display_order: Number.isFinite(payload.displayOrder) ? Number(payload.displayOrder) : 100,
created_at: new Date(),
updated_at: new Date(),
};
// Schema-drift guard — migration 131 adds these columns. On installs
// that haven't migrated yet, only EN+DE bodies persist; the other
// four fields are accepted from the payload but silently dropped.
for (const [field, payloadKey] of [
['body_text_ru', 'bodyTextRu'],
['body_text_pt', 'bodyTextPt'],
['body_text_nl', 'bodyTextNl'],
['body_text_fr', 'bodyTextFr'],
]) {
if (payload[payloadKey] != null
&& await hasColumnCached('contract_blocks', field)) {
row[field] = payload[payloadKey] ? String(payload[payloadKey]) : null;
}
}
const inserted = await db('contract_blocks').insert(row).returning('id');
const id = typeof inserted[0] === 'object' ? inserted[0].id : inserted[0];
return await getBlockById(id);
}
/**
* Update a block. System blocks: every field is editable so the
* admin's lawyer can rewrite the body text in place. The only
* protection on system blocks is that they can't be hard-deleted —
* an admin who wants to retire one toggles `is_active=false`.
*/
async function updateBlock(id, payload) {
const existing = await getBlockById(id);
if (!existing) throw new AppError('Block not found', 404);
const updates = { updated_at: new Date() };
if ('section' in payload) {
ensureSection(payload.section);
updates.section = payload.section;
}
if ('name' in payload) {
if (!payload.name || !String(payload.name).trim()) {
throw new AppError('Block name is required', 400);
}
updates.name = String(payload.name).trim().slice(0, 128);
}
if ('description' in payload) {
updates.description = payload.description ? String(payload.description).slice(0, 255) : null;
}
if ('bodyText' in payload) {
if (!payload.bodyText || !String(payload.bodyText).trim()) {
throw new AppError('Block body (EN) is required', 400);
}
updates.body_text = String(payload.bodyText);
}
if ('bodyTextDe' in payload) {
updates.body_text_de = payload.bodyTextDe ? String(payload.bodyTextDe) : null;
}
// Same schema-drift guard as createBlock — accept ru/pt/nl/fr only
// when the column actually exists, so beta installs running this
// service against a not-yet-migrated DB don't throw.
for (const [field, payloadKey] of [
['body_text_ru', 'bodyTextRu'],
['body_text_pt', 'bodyTextPt'],
['body_text_nl', 'bodyTextNl'],
['body_text_fr', 'bodyTextFr'],
]) {
if (payloadKey in payload
&& await hasColumnCached('contract_blocks', field)) {
updates[field] = payload[payloadKey] ? String(payload[payloadKey]) : null;
}
}
if ('isActive' in payload) {
updates.is_active = payload.isActive !== false;
}
if ('displayOrder' in payload && Number.isFinite(payload.displayOrder)) {
updates.display_order = Number(payload.displayOrder);
}
await db('contract_blocks').where({ id }).update(updates);
return await getBlockById(id);
}
/**
* Hard-delete an admin-authored block. System blocks refuse delete —
* the admin must `deactivate` (toggle `is_active=false`) instead.
*
* Active inclusions on existing contracts are protected by the FK
* ON DELETE RESTRICT — deleting a block that's still referenced will
* raise a DB error which we catch and surface as a clean 409.
*/
async function deleteBlock(id) {
const existing = await getBlockById(id);
if (!existing) throw new AppError('Block not found', 404);
if (existing.is_system) {
throw new AppError(
'System blocks cannot be deleted. Toggle them inactive instead so they remain available for audit on old contracts.',
409,
'SYSTEM_BLOCK_PROTECTED',
);
}
try {
await db('contract_blocks').where({ id }).del();
} catch (err) {
if (/foreign key|FOREIGN KEY|RESTRICT/i.test(err.message)) {
throw new AppError(
'This block is referenced by one or more contracts. Toggle it inactive instead of deleting.',
409,
'BLOCK_IN_USE',
);
}
throw err;
}
return { id };
}
